The chronological (and probably all algos) should not show duplicates. As i scroll down I see the same note several times.
One Algo could be trending, sorted by comments/reactions/zaps within last 24 hours or something similar.
When I enter a note and return to the timeline, it should return to the same spot. Currently it doesn’t.
When new notes are downloaded as I scroll, leave my timeline where I’m currently scrolling, don’t reset me to the latest download.
These are pain points that make my Damus usage very inefficient.
